Costume Design is the 1061st most popular major in the country with 80 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.
At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 28 costume design graduates with average earnings and debt of $38,303 and $24,501 respectively.

Out of the 8 schools in the Best Value Costume Design Schools for a Bachelor’s For Those Making $75-$110k that were part of this year’s ranking, Webster University landed the #1 spot on the list. Webster is a private not-for-profit institution located in Saint Louis, Missouri. The school has a medium-sized population, and it awarded 6 bachelors’s degrees in 2019-2020.
Webster also made our “Best Costume Design Bachelor’s Degree Schools” list, coming in at #1. The estimated yearly cost for Webster University is $24,584 for bachelor’s degree costume design students whose families make $75-$110k.
The student loan default rate at the school is 4.9%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
